About City of Milford Public Works

Currently, 8,272 customers are supplied electricity by the company. These customers are a mix of 6,620 residential customers, 1,642 commercial customers and 10 industrial customers. City of Milford Public Works' consumers spend, on average, 14.63 cents per kilowatt hour for their electricity, which is 11.69% less than the average Delaware price of 16.57 cents. The company had sales of 228,636 megawatt hours in 2023 sold to end users. During the same timeframe, City of Milford Public Works purchased 242,050 megawatt hours through wholesale channels. In 2023, City of Milford Public Works had $28,716,900 in total revenue solely through retail electricity sales.

The average residential electricity bill for a consumer of City of Milford Public Works is $157.86 per month. Customers of the company pay a 3.49% markup compared to other residents of the state. Electricity generation is not part of the City of Milford Public Works business model, as they purchase power at wholesale rates and then resell to their end users.

Energy Loss

All electricity suppliers who generate electricity suffer from some energy loss via heat depletion or alternative factors. City of Milford Public Works is not an exception, as they average a yearly loss of around 2.84% of the total electricity they produce. The state of Delaware has an energy loss average of 3.94% and the countrywide average is 2.43%, resulting in City of Milford Public Works receiving a rank of 486th best out of 3530 providers reporting energy loss in the country.
